I suppose 4 skates is enough for initial findings!

Glove feels better on my hand than my EFlex 600. The steeper thumb to pocket angle directs everything into the pocket, I would occasionally have the puck just bounce off my thumb before. I found that not using the wrist strap works best for me, I like to keep my C/A wrist loose and that would cause some glove interference.  The two other adjustment straps keep my hand locked in perfectly.

Blocker is what took me the longest to get adjusted to. I found myself dropping my stick while doing casual movements. I suppose the stick shaft would "lock in" with my EFlex but not with the McKenney. I started to tighten up my grip to alleviate this problem; it's more muscle memory than issues with the blocker. On the plus side, holding the water bottle is much easier in the McKenney.

I don't play the puck too often but have not had any issues when doing so. I haven't had any issues with protection either, no stingers yet, very pleased with the purchase so far!

@Candyman - what are your thoughts on the gloves after a few months of having them?

Hi @jerd31, I don't have any complaints about the gloves, they are working out great. The steeper thumb angle on the glove has reduced the amount of pop-outs when catching pucks and no stingers to date. I did remove the wrist strap on the catcher as the finger and palm connection points are more than enough. The blocker is well balanced and I no longer drop my stick as I'm used to the connection point with the stick. Overall I'm very pleased with the purchase in terms of fit, feel; performance and price!
